Questions & Answers
The cheapest way to get from Issaquah to Port Townsend is to line 554 bus and line 404 ferry and bus which costs $7 - $17 and takes 4h 40m.
The fastest way to get from Issaquah to Port Townsend is to drive which takes 2h 27m and costs $20 - $30.
No, there is no direct bus from Issaquah to Port Townsend. However, there are services departing from E Sunset Way & 1st Ave NE and arriving at Haines Place Park and Ride via Seattle Amtrak Station and Four Corners Park & Ride.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 4h 46m.
The distance between Issaquah and Port Townsend is 67 miles. The road distance is 115.3 miles.
The best way to get from Issaquah to Port Townsend without a car is to line 554 bus and line 404 ferry and bus which takes 4h 40m and costs $7 - $17.
It takes approximately 4h 40m to get from Issaquah to Port Townsend, including transfers.
Issaquah to Port Townsend bus services, operated by Dungeness Line - Olympic, depart from Seattle Amtrak Station.
Issaquah to Port Townsend bus services, operated by Dungeness Line - Olympic, arrive at 63 Four Corners Park & Ride station.
Yes, the driving distance between Issaquah to Port Townsend is 115 miles. It takes approximately 2h 27m to drive from Issaquah to Port Townsend.
